Netflix Unveils Trailer for True-Crime Doc Stolen: Heist of the Century
Image
Launching August 8 on Netflix, Stolen: Heist of the Century is the latest jaw-dropping documentary film from Raw in association with Amblin Documentaries (producers of Big Vape: The Rise and Fall of Juul) and in collaboration with Wildside.

The ultimate true-life crime caper, Stolen: Heist of the Century, tells the story of the world’s greatest diamond heist. For the first time, the Antwerp detectives who cracked the case and the alleged criminal mastermind assemble to give a blow-by-blow account of what really happened and reveal the secrets of “The Heist of the Century.”

On the morning of February 17, 2003, detectives from Antwerp’s infamous “Diamond Squad” were called to investigate the brazen night-time robbery of an allegedly impregnable vault in the middle of the City of Diamonds.

It is estimated that between 100 million and half a billion dollars’ worth of diamonds were stolen – and have never been found. An ingenious gang...

‘Resident Alien’ Canceled Ahead of Season 4 Finale on USA Network
Image
Pour one out for “Resident Alien.” The science fiction comedy/mystery has been canceled by USA Network with three more episodes left to air in the current Season 4, TheWrap has learned.

The show, starring fan favorite Alan Tudyk, will air its final episode Aug. 8.

The series debuted in 2021 on SyFy and remained there for its first three seasons. It was renewed for Season 4 in 2023 and relocated to USA Network at the same time.

Based on the Dark Horse comics, “Resident Alien” centers on Harry (Tudyk), a crash-landed alien whose secret mission is to kill all humans, who has taken on the appearance of one such murdered human to live among them. Sara Tomko, Corey Reynolds, Alice Wetterlund, Levi Fiehler, Elizabeth Bowen, Judah Prehn and Meredith Garretson also starred.

Chris Sheridan adapted the show for television and served as showrunner, as well as an executive producer alongside Mike Richardson and Keith Goldberg of Dark Horse Entertainment,...

Cape Fear TV series: Amy Adams to star with Javier Bardem
Image
At one point in time, Steven Spielberg was set to direct the thriller Cape Fear, while Martin Scorsese was attached to direct the historical drama Schindler’s List. Then Scorsese decided to step away from Schindler’s List, a choice that coincided with Spielberg deciding that Cape Fear was too violent for him. So the directors traded movies – resulting in Scorsese directing Robert De Niro and Juliette Lewis to Oscar nominations for Cape Fear and Spielberg turning Schindler’s List into a Best Picture winner. Now, Spielberg and Scorsese are teaming up to executive produce a TV series adaptation of Cape Fear, with Nick Antosca on board as executive producer and showrunner – and Deadline reports that Amy Adams (Man of Steel) has signed on to star in and executive produce the series!

Adams joins the previously announced cast member Javier Bardem, who is set to play the villainous Max Cady...

Javier Bardem Joins ‘Cape Fear’ TV Series with Spielberg and Scorsese Producing!
Image
Back in 2023, Apple TV+ officially ordered a series adaptation of ‘Cape Fear.’ The show is set to adapt Universal’s 1991 remake of a 1962 film under the same name, which was in turn based on the 1957 novel ‘The Executioner’ written by John D. MacDonald.

The film is about a convicted rapist who uses his knowledge of the law and its loopholes to seek revenge on a former public defender. He blames the lawyer for his 14-year prison sentence, claiming the lawyer purposely sabotaged his defense during the trial.

The series is being developed by UCP and Amblin. It will be the first TV project that Martin Scorsese and Steven Spielberg worked on together. They are executive producers along with showrunner Nick Antosca, who has worked on shows like ‘Channel Zero’ and ‘The Act.’ Other executive producers include Darryl Frank and Justin Falvey from Amblin, and Alex Hedlund from Eat the Cat.
